What Is Crypto?

Cryptocurrency is a digital or virtual currency that uses cryptography for security and anti-counterfeiting measures.

The first cryptocurrency was Bitcoin, which was created in 2009 by an anonymous programmer, or group of programmers, under the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to. Bitcoin uses SHA-256, which is a set of cryptographic hash functions developed by the US National Security Agency.

As of June 2022, there were over 6800 cryptocurrencies and more than 3,500 active blockchain projects worldwide.

What is Bitcoin?

Bitcoin is a cryptocurrency that exists on the internet. It’s made up of digital bits and bytes and it isn’t controlled by any one person or company. It can be used to buy and sell products and services, just like cash.

Bitcoin was invented by an unknown person or group of people in 2008, who used the name Satoshi Nakamoto for the project. The true identity of this person or group of people has not been confirmed by anyone at Bitcoin Magazine or elsewhere and there are no clear answers yet.

Bitcoin is also known as a ‘decentralized digital currency’, which means it doesn’t belong to any one company or government body. Instead, it functions using peer-to-peer technology — meaning there is no central server that controls all transactions, but instead they happen directly between users via their computers (or smartphones).

The term ‘cryptocurrency’ refers to any form of money that exists only online, such as Bitcoin.
